Apical extrusion of debris by supplementary files used for retreatment: An ex vivo comparative study

J Conserv Dent. 2016 Mar-Apr;19(2):125-9. doi: 10.4103/0972-0707.178686.

Abstract

Aim: This study evaluated whether using supplementary files for removing root canal filling residues after ProTaper Universal Retreatment files (RFs) increased the debris extrusion apically.

Materials and methods: Eighty mandibular premolars with single root and canal were instrumented with ProTaper Universal rotary system (SX-F3) and obturated. The samples were divided randomly into four groups (n = 20). Group 1 served as a control; only ProTaper Universal RFs D1-D3 were used, and the extruded debris was weighed. Groups 2, 3, and 4 were the experimental groups, receiving a twofold retreatment protocol: Removal of the bulk, followed by the use of supplementary files. The bulk was removed by RFs, followed by the use of ProTaper NEXT (PTN), WaveOne (WO), and Self-Adjusting File (SAF) for removal of the remaining root filling residues. Debris extruded apically were weighed and compared to the control group. Statistical analysis was performed using one-way analysis of variance (ANOVA) and post hoc Tukey's test.

Results: All the three experimental groups presented significant difference (P < .01). The post hoc Tukey's test confirmed that Group 4 (SAF) exhibited significantly less (P < .01) debris extrusion between the three groups tested.

Conclusion: SAF results in less extrusion of debris when used as supplementary file to remove root-filling residues, compared to WO and PTN.
